Canton is a village in St. Lawrence County, New York, United States. The population was 5,882 at the 2000 census. It is the county seat of St. Lawrence County. The name comes from the Chinese city, Canton.
The Village of Canton is centrally located in both the Town of Canton and St. Lawrence County.
The Village of Canton contains many municipal services such as a fully functional village highway department, water and sewer department, volunteer fire department, court system and a police department along with other municipal agencies.
Canton Village Police Department is located in the municipal building on Main Street. It is comprised of a Chief of Police, three sergeants and five patrolman. The department has two full time dispatchers and a part time dispatcher. The department is manned 24 hours a day/7 days a week and when they do not have a dispatcher, the calls are forwarded to the St. Lawrence County Sheriffs Department which is housed with the State Police and Emergency services in the 911 building on Court Street. The Canton Village Police Department works closely with the Sheriffs Department, State Police, SUNY Canton Police and St. Lawrence University Security and Safety. Being a college town with two - four year colleges within the village (SUNY Canton and St. Lawrence University), the Canton Police Department has a high volume of calls year long. The village police are frequently requested to assist both SUNY Canton and SLU in criminal matters and investigations. The department is one of the few agencies in the state to be an accredited agency since 1993. (...) more....
